UCAS Similarity Detection Service - guidance for applicants This guide is designed to help UCAS applicants understand our similarity detection process. Eliminated words The Copycatch process ignores commonly used words that many applicants use in their statements such as and so and with. Page 1 of 4 Copycatch also ignores a selection of commonly used words and phrases including Duke of Edinburgh and football.
